Haley, Jessica, Liz

My cousin Jessica remarked

that at least now Grandma

has one of her kids in heaven

to have morning tea with

 

this is a really nice thought

even though it does not necessarily fit

what I think the afterlife might be like

with mouths to drink and kitchen tables

 

My cousin Liz reminded

me to be gentle and loving

with myself which is good advice

that I forget to take

 

two months later on Easter

when I am freaking out

because my Mum would never have served

spaghetti and meatballs for Easter Dinner

 

My cousin Haley called

later that day on Easter

to tell me she love love love

love love love loves me

 

and in the background I could hear

some of my littlest cousins

yelling about chocolate

clamoring for more

 

(This is where there is a lesson

about the continuity of youth and family

and the communion of saints

and the forgiveness of sins

 

and twenty years ago Liz was my age

and grieving her lost but living family

and I was the little cousin

clamoring in the background

 

and the resurrection of the body

and the life everlasting

but maybe I just miss going to church

and maybe I wish Jessica was right)
